Communities outline summer event dates and coordination; Myton updating website to help promote

Duchesne County Council of Governments · January 26, 2026

Summary

Cities and towns in Duchesne County reviewed upcoming event dates including Myton Daze (June 25–27), Tabiona's July 4 parade, Altamont Long Horn Days (July 20–25), UBIC (July 27–Aug 1) and the County Fair (Aug 3–8); Myton City said it will update its website to coordinate promotion.

Council members and staff reviewed a slate of community events and coordination opportunities for 2026. Dates noted in the minutes included Myton Daze (June 25–27, with a parade on June 27), Tabiona's July 4 parade, Altamont Long Horn Days (July 20–25), UBIC July 27–Aug. 1, and the County Fair Aug. 3–8; the minutes also list a Holly Fair on Nov. 6–7 and an Enchanted Forest in the third week of November. Roosevelt reported it will not hold a July 4 parade but will host a car show.

Myton City said it is updating its website and asked to coordinate promotion of events across jurisdictions. The notices were informational; no formal action or funding decisions were taken at the meeting.
